North America is a continent entirely within the Northern Hemisphere and almost all within the Western Hemisphere. It can also be considered a northern subcontinent of the Americas. It is bordered to the north by the Arctic Ocean, to the east by the Atlantic Ocean, to the west and south by the Pacific Ocean, and to the southeast by South America and the Caribbean Sea.
North America covers an area of about 24,709,000 square kilometers (9,540,000 square miles), about 16.5% of the earth's land area and about 4.8% of its total surface. North America is the third largest continent by area, following Asia and Africa, and the fourth by population after Asia, Africa, and Europe.
In 2013, its population was estimated at nearly 565 million people in 23 independent states, or about 7.5% of the world's population, if nearby islands (most notably the Caribbean) are included.
North America was reached by its first human populations during the last glacial period, via crossing the Bering land bridge. The so-called Paleo-Indian period is taken to have lasted until about 10,000 years ago (the beginning of the Archaic or Meso-Indian period). The Classic stage spans roughly the 6th to 13th centuries. The Pre-Columbian era ended with the arrival of European settlers during the Age of Discovery and the Early Modern period. Present-day cultural and ethnic patterns reflect different kind of interactions between European colonists, indigenous peoples, African slaves and their descendants. European influences are strongest in the northern parts of the continent while indigenous and African influences are relatively stronger in the south. Because of the history of colonialism, most North Americans speak English, Spanish or French and societies and states commonly reflect Western traditions.

For all soccer fans everywhere. This is the full broadcast of the 1977 North American Soccer League championship match, Soccer Bowl 77, which was between the New York Cosmos and the Seattle Sounders. The match was held at Civic Stadium (now known as JELD-WEN Field) in Portland, Oregon. This match is significant because it was Pele's last competitive match as a player. He helped give the North American Soccer League the boost of credibility it needed when he signed with the Cosmos in 1975. This match was televised by the independent TVS network, with Jon Miller and Paul Gardner providing the commentary. For those wondering, it's the same Jon Miller from the ESPN baseball telecasts. At last...the definitive highlights compilation from the 1973 North American Soccer League title match. On August 25, 1973, 18,824 fans filed into Texas Stadium in Irving, Texas to watch their Dallas Tornado--1971 NASL champions--take on the expansion Philadelphia Atoms. Dallas were heavily favored: besides having experience, the home side also had the NASL's leading scorer, American rookie Kyle Rote, Jr. Also, the Atoms would be without their two top scorers, as league commitments found loan players Andy "The Flea" Provan and Jim Fryatt recalled the Southport for the English season. Nevertheless, American-born coach Al Miller started six native born players in his lineup (an unheard of number at the time), including never-used defender Bill Straub at forward for the absent Fryatt. The North American Soccer League (NASL) is a professional men's soccer league with ten teams in the United States and Canada. It is sanctioned by the United States Soccer Federation (U.S. Soccer) as the Division II league in the American league system, under Major League Soccer (MLS) and above USL Pro. Its headquarters are in New York City. The league is named for, but has no connection to, the original North American Soccer League. The modern NASL was founded in 2009, and began play in 2011 following a 2010 season that saw NASL and USL teams play in a combined temporary Division II league. The New York Cosmos started a soccer revolution in the 1970s, bringing international stars such as Pele, Beckenbauer and Chinaglia to America. The Cosmos packed Giants Stadium and won five championships before the NASL went under and the dream ended. But in the 2009 the all-new North American Soccer League was launched, and in 2013, the New York Cosmos were reborn. In what many consider to be the greatest match in the history of the original North American Soccer League, this is ABC's broadcast of the second leg of the 1979 National Soccer Conference final between the Vancouver Whitecaps and the defending NASL champion New York Cosmos. This match was held at the now-demolished Giants Stadium in East Rutherford, New Jersey. Vancouver had taken the first leg of the NSC final in Vancouver by a score of 2-0. For the Cosmos to advance to the Soccer Bowl, they would have to win this leg, then win a 30-minute 'mini-game' after that. This video shows the first half of the match.
